Read this report, ".....The government attempted to regulate the foreign exchange marketthrough a two-tier pricing system. Essential goods and services were to bepurchased at an official rate, while non-essential goods and services at amarket rate. The system soon broke down because strategically positionedpublic officials could buy on the official rate and sell through the ‘kibanda’or black market. Despite the war, during this four-year period (1981-85)there were some gains. GDP grew by 5.5 per cent and inflation fell to about20 per cent, while the current account was in surplus (Edmonds, 1998). Percapita incomes recovered from a low of US$136 per annum to US$187 perannum and the share of agriculture in GDP fell from 70.5 per cent in 1980 to50.5 per cent in 1985. Yet this first attempt to stabilize and improve economicperformance is largely remembered as a failure because of the continuinginstability. Exports fell from US$415 million in 1980 to US$368 million in1984 while the external debt rose from US$568 million to over US$1 billionin 1985. Inflation had initially been tamed by external aid and reliefassistance, but shot from 47.4 to 156 per cent, between 1983 and 1985."
